Tryptone Glucose Extract Broth w/TTC

Description:
Tryptone Glucose Extract Broth with TTC
Qty/Pk:
Applications:
A non-selective medium used to detect total heterotrophic microorganisms in water and other liquids. TTC is used as an indicator for easy enumeration.

Organism Appearance:
Colonies appear red. Red color in the colonies is produced by reduction of triphenyl tetrazolium chloride (TTC)
